Harry Potter

Harry Potter is a boy that was marked at birth by Voldemort, which tried to murder little Harry as a child and failed. Though, he did end up killing Harry's parents leaving Harry alone with his evil Aunt, Uncle and Cousin. Then he finds that he is a wizard from this big cool guy named Hagrid. Then he goes to this school for magic folk every year, ending up in wacky mishaps with his two best friends Ron and Hermione. That's not all, he has to kill Voldemort because of this prophecy made by this old sheer that teaches at his school because if he don't terrible things could happen....now it's up to Harry to save the wizarding world.
